Vivian Quiroga Klein
Spanish & Latin Teacher

Vivian Quiroga Klein has taught Spanish and Latin at Eliot since 1998. She was born in Cochabamba, Bolivia. Mrs. Quiroga Klein received a BA in Modern Language from Boston College and she is licensed by the state of Massachusetts to teach Spanish grades 5 to 12. She readily shares her love of the Hispanic culture and tradition with Eliot students through the materials she brings to the classroom, through cooking, singing, and dancing with the students. 

In 2002 Mrs. Quiroga Klein received a grant from the Embassy of Spain to study at the Universidade Santiago de Compostela in Galicia and in the summer of 2006 she traveled to Havana, Cuba to present at the V International Colloquium of Music and Poetry Nicolás Guillén. 

She also shares an interest in the classics and she serves on the board of ETC, Excellence through Classics, an organization for teachers of Latin and Greek at the elementary school level.
